Why Tracking Peptide Injection Site Reactions Matters
If you’re asking “why track peptide injection site reactions,” start with a simple definition. An injection‑site reaction (ISR) is any local redness, swelling, pain, or lump where you injected a peptide. ISRs are common; clinical reports show rates between 12% and 28% across peptide and GLP‑1 studies (Injection‑site and dermatologic reactions associated with GLP‑1 RAs).
Systematic tracking helps you spot patterns that chance notes miss. Regular logs make it easier to detect trends that could indicate immunogenicity or formulation issues, a priority in peptide safety reviews (Beyond Efficacy: Ensuring Safety in Peptide Therapeutics). Structured ISR records also prompt faster follow‑up; one analysis found a 40% higher likelihood of clinician action when users logged reactions in a consistent tracker (Safety and Efficacy of Peptide‑Based Therapeutics).
Safety guidelines recommend recording at least three data points per injection, such as site, severity, and duration, to make notes clinically useful (Peptide Safety Protocols – Clinical Guidelines). Step‑by‑Step Process to Track Injection Site Reactions
Start with a brief note: a consistent, structured log makes it easier to spot patterns and avoid repeat-site irritation. Follow this 7-step workflow to capture useful, clinician-ready notes after each peptide injection.
- Step 1: Choose a dedicated tracking tool Pick one place to keep every injection and reaction note. Why this matters: a single tracker reduces fragmentation and lowers repeat-site reactions by improving site rotation and history (observational data shows about 30% fewer repeat-site reactions with logging). (Injection Log Template – Clarity DTX) Pitfall: using multiple apps or scattered notes increases error and forgetfulness.
-
Step 2: Set up your reaction log template Create a simple template with key fields you will fill each time. Why this matters: standard fields make entries consistent and comparable across injections, improving pattern detection. (Injection Log Template – Clarity DTX) Pitfall: omitting pain severity or duration makes it hard to judge whether a reaction is changing.
-
Step 3: Record the injection details immediately after the shot Log dose, site, and any immediate sensations right away. Why this matters: immediate entry reduces recall bias and preserves accurate details for later review. Pitfall: delayed entry leads to vague notes and weak trend data.
-
Step 4: Capture reaction specifics within the first 240148a0hours Note redness size, swelling, pain on a 1a05 scale, and how long each sign lasts. Why this matters: many injection-site reactions appear and change in the first 24–72 hours; capturing early specifics improves context for clinicians and supports safe monitoring. (Peptide Injection Site Reactions – Jay Campbell; Beyond Efficacy: Ensuring Safety in Peptide Therapeutics) Pitfall: vague descriptors like “a little” or “ok” make trend analysis impossible.
-
Step 5: Add contextual factors Record food intake, activity level, recent medications, and injection technique notes. Why this matters: context helps separate injection reactions from unrelated skin or systemic events. (Peptide Safety Protocols – Clinical Guidelines) Pitfall: ignoring context can hide causes or contributors to reactions.
-
Step 6: Review weekly trends Summarize the week’s entries to spot recurring sites, reaction patterns, and timing. Why this matters: weekly review turns individual events into meaningful trends you can discuss with a clinician. (Beyond Efficacy: Ensuring Safety in Peptide Therapeutics) Pitfall: skipping reviews lets small signals become missed problems.
-
Step 7: Export or share the log with your clinician before appointments Prepare a concise report that highlights dates, sites, reaction severity, and notable patterns. Why this matters: a clear summary saves time during visits and improves the quality of clinical conversations. (Peptide Safety Protocols – Clinical Guidelines) Pitfall: sending raw screenshots or fragmented notes forces clinicians to piece together your history.

Troubleshooting Common Tracking Issues
Shot logs often feel incomplete for simple reasons: busy days, vague notes, and too many fields. About 20% of manual injection logs are incomplete when users rely on memory or delayed entry (Revolution Health). Missing outcome data also hurts safety reviews and trial reporting (see the regulatory analysis on trial data completeness (Beyond Efficacy)).
- Forgot to log right after injection — people delay entries when they lack a quick trigger. Set an immediate reminder to nudge a one‑minute entry.
-
Vague descriptions — entries like “sore” or “fine” don’t show change over time. Use standardized scales (for example, 0–10 pain and millimeters for size) so future comparisons are clear.
-
Too much detail — long freeform notes make logging slow and inconsistent. Focus on core fields: date, site, severity, and duration to keep entries fast.
Make small process changes you can keep. Automate reminders and build a one‑minute habit to cut the 2–3 day entry lag that affects up to 20% of shots (Revolution Health).
